From 16 until 19 May 2015, in Plovdiv, Bulgaria, local governments of South-East Europe will gather at the Annual Forum of Local Authorities of South East Europe. The event will include:
- Site-visits to successful projects of the City of Plovdiv
- Business fair
- Municipal projects market
- NALAS General Assembly Meeting
- NAMRB General Assembly Meeting
- Award Ceremony for the GENiYOUTH Munipal Initiatives for involving women and young people in the activities of the local authorities
- Award Ceremony for the European Label of Good Governance
- Conference: Local Authorities' Competences and Preparedness for Crisis Prevention and Management
At the event, the President of the Republic of Bulgaria, Rossen Plevneliev, will have his address. Also, speeches will be delivered by Ms. Barbara Toce, Vice-President of the Congress of Local and Regional Authorities of the Council of Europe, Mr. Gazmend Turdiu, Deputy Secretary General of the Regional Cooperation Council, Ms. Ivelina Vasileva, Minister of Environent and Water, Ms. Liliyana Pavlova, Minister of Regional Development and Public Works, Mr. Walter Kling, Secretary General of the International Association of Water, as well as numerous Mayors from South-East Europe.
